The Lowest Common Ancestor (LCA) of two nodes and in a rooted tree is the lowest (deepest) node that is an ancestor of both and .
For any node, if the given node is found in either its left subtree or its right subtree, then the current node is an ancestor of it. The k th ancestor of a tree node is the k th node in the path from that node to the root node. What is the most efficient/elegant way to parse a flat table into a tree?
